gerido.blogg.se

Android clean architecture kotlin github
Android clean architecture kotlin github






android clean architecture kotlin github

So that's it! You can find the full code and working project from my Github. Observer will get triggered after calling postValue() in getUpdatedText() function and then the MainFragment can update the UI text element with the updated data. Clean Architecture divided into 3 layers. The android clean architecture implementation could make your code are clean inside your business application, also your code will be testable easily than before. Next we add a MutableLiveData which will trigger an update for our observer that we created in MainFragment. Kotlin FLow MVVM + Clean Architecture Above is the Clean Architecture flow that shows how the data is requested until data is presented. Rick And Morty Jetpack Compose Sample App. Sample Android Clean Architecture on App focused on written in Kotlin. First we create a DataModel so we can have a text that's going to get updated after clicking a button. A Best Android project in GitHub - Sample Android Clean Architecture on App focused on written in Kotlin. So like I said earlier, viewModel is taking care of the logic that's not directly related to UI objects.

android clean architecture kotlin github android clean architecture kotlin github

*/ class MainFragment : Fragment () Įnter fullscreen mode Exit fullscreen mode * - listens to viewModel for updates on UI Package import android.os.Bundle import import import import import import import import .FragmentMainBinding import .MainViewModel /*








Android clean architecture kotlin github